What goals does Liftcraft support?+
Liftcraft builds programs around four core goals: building muscle, getting stronger, getting toned, and training around an injury. Each goal gets a methodology that fits the target — hypertrophy blocks for muscle, strength waves for strength, higher-rep volume work for toning, and lumbar-aware design for back issues. Then Liftcraft learns from every set you log and automatically raises or lowers your weights, tweaks your sets and reps, and adjusts your exercises based on how you're actually progressing.

What is MCP and do I need it?+
MCP (Model Context Protocol) is Anthropic's standard for connecting AI tools to external data. Liftcraft's MCP server lets Claude Desktop or ChatGPT directly build programs in your account. Most users won't need it — you can simply pick a premade program from the library or paste output from ChatGPT or Claude.
